Collinear antenna 890-930 MHz (6 dBi): Professional amplification for electronic warfare and communications
In today's electronic warfare environment, control over the 900 MHz frequency range is a strategically important task. Collinear antenna 890-930 MHz with 6 dBi gain is high-precision equipment designed to stabilize the operation of electronic warfare systems and tactical communications nodes. Due to its narrow specialization and high efficiency, this antenna provides maximum effectiveness in suppressing enemy control and telemetry channels.
Key advantages of the collinear design 890-930 MHz
The 890-930 MHz band is a "workhorse" for many UAV control systems (in particular, the ELRS and Crossfire protocols on the corresponding frequencies). Using a collinear antenna instead of standard solutions offers a number of significant advantages:
- Focus on the horizon: A narrow vertical radiation pattern (17°) concentrates all transmitter power parallel to the ground. You don't waste energy "up in the sky," but direct it directly against ground or low-flying targets.
- Omnidirectional coverage (360°): The antenna creates a uniform radio field around the object, which eliminates the appearance of "dead zones" through which an enemy drone could bypass the defense system.
- High power: The ability to withstand a load of up to 70 W allows the antenna to be used with the most powerful digital jamming modules (VCO).
Technical and tactical characteristics (TTX)
The antenna parameters are optimized for professional use, providing a stable SWR indicator across the entire operating spectrum.
| Parameter | Characteristic value |
|---|---|
| Operating frequency range | 890 - 930 MHz |
| Gain | 6 ±1 dBi |
| SWR | ≤ 2,0 |
| Polarization | Vertical |
| Horizontal Beamwidth | 360º (Omnidirectional) |
| Vertical Beamwidth | 17 ± 3º (concentration along the horizon) |
| Input impedance | 50 Ohm |
| Maximum power | 70 watts (peak) |
| Connector type | N-Male (Plug) |

Tactical FAQ:Six Questions About the Collinear Antenna (900 MHz "Scale")
Why is the 890-930 MHz band considered the "heart" of the 900 band?
This is the most critical part of the airwaves. This is where the TBS Crossfire (915 MHz) protocols and the upper limit of ELRS operate. The antenna provides maximum suppression efficiency for drones at long ranges. This is your primary defense against "professional" kamikazes.
What does 5 dBi gain provide for the shape of the protective dome?
5 dBi is the perfect balance. The antenna compresses the signal into a "fat donut" shape. It hits significantly further along the horizon than a regular antenna, but maintains dense coverage at the top to prevent the miss of a drone entering at an angle.
What is the advantage of a collinear design over a regular one?
A collinear antenna is a stack of emitters. It works like a softbox in photography: the same amount of energy, but it is directed much more precisely where it is needed, which increases the "jamming" range without unnecessary costs.
Impact on a laptop, Starlink, and mobile communications?
Electronic warfare in this range is safe for Starlink and Wi-Fi. You can study notes or play Bannerlord under the protection of the dome. However, GSM-900 mobile communication inside a car can be completely lost - take this into account when communicating with a group.
Correct installation on the roof of a car?
The antenna should be located in the center of the metal roof. It serves as a reflector (ground plane). If you transport tripods or stands on the roof, make sure that they do not block the antenna's view, otherwise a "blind spot" will occur.
The main danger when using such an antenna?
Frequency mismatch. If you connect the antenna to a module of a different range, a high SWR will occur. The energy will return to the device, and the module will burn out instantly. Always check the frequency markings on the antenna and module before turning it on.
